Illustrate defect spoilage and defect age?
Expert
Defect spoilage and Defect age metrics work with the same principle that is, how late you have found the defect. Defect age is also known as a phase age. The most important thing to consider in testing is that the more time we take to find a defect the more it will costs to fix it. So it is necessary to define the scale of the defect age according to phases.
After deciding the scale we can find the defect spoilage. Defect spoilage are defects from the earlier phase multiplied by the scale.
